Introduction: The Global Landscape of Front End Loaders

Front-end loaders, often referred to as wheel loaders, are the heavy-duty machinery workhorses of global construction, open-cast mining, municipal engineering, bulk warehousing, and agricultural infrastructure. These machines are engineered to transport loose materials such as earth, gravel, sand, iron ore, and agricultural bulk with high cycle efficiency. The global market is experiencing significant transformation, driven by infrastructure investments in emerging economies, shifting regulatory frameworks demanding lower emissions (US EPA Tier 4 Final & EU Stage V), and the integration of digital telematics.

For B2B buyers, fleet managers, and procurement professionals, selecting the right partner from the leading front-end loader manufacturers is not simply a matter of initial purchase price. The evaluation must center on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O), hydraulic integration reliability, structural longevity under fatigue, and the accessibility of a robust local supply chain and aftermarket support system.

Key Evaluation Benchmarks for Selecting Loader Suppliers

Before highlighting the top industry manufacturers, it is essential to outline the core technical parameters that define a premium supplier:

  • Hydraulic System Efficiency: Look for manufacturers utilizing dual-pump confluence technologies, hydraulic sensing systems, and premium control valves (e.g., Husco, Kawasaki, or Rexroth) that reduce hydraulic response latency and optimize fuel economy.
  • Chassis & Structural Integrity: The heavy-duty front frame, loader arm, and rear chassis must undergo Finite Element Analysis (FEA) to ensure structural stress is evenly distributed, minimizing welding seam cracks under extreme breakout forces.
  • Powertrain Coordination: Seamless calibration between the engine (e.g., Cummins, Perkins, Weichai) and the hydrostatic transmission system or heavy-duty planetary gearbox ensures optimal torque multiplication during digging.

Industry Insight: Transition to Electrification

The compact and mid-sized loader sectors are shifting rapidly toward Lithium Iron Phosphate (LFP) battery technology. Electric front-end loaders deliver zero operating emissions, drastically lower decibel ratings for municipal projects, and reduce operational expenditures by up to 60% compared to traditional diesel alternatives.

Top 10 Front End Loader Manufacturers Globally

To assist procurement managers, here is a benchmarking overview of the top 10 players in the global front-end loader and earthmoving machinery industry:

1. Caterpillar Inc. (USA)

Renowned globally for premium reliability, proprietary power systems, and unmatched dealer networks. Ideal for high-tonnage mining and quarrying applications where uptime is critical.

2. Komatsu Ltd. (Japan)

A technological pioneer in intelligent machine control and heavy-duty hybrid loaders. Their advanced hydraulic efficiency is widely praised in infrastructure projects.

3. Volvo Construction Equipment (Sweden)

Focuses on operator comfort, environmental sustainability, and highly efficient torque parallel linkage. A leader in electric heavy machinery innovation.

4. Liebherr Group (Germany)

Specialized hydrostatic drivelines that offer extreme fuel savings and exceptional low-speed pushing force. Highly popular in European waste handling and mining.

5. XCMG Group (China)

A giant in high-tonnage Chinese heavy equipment, manufacturing heavy loaders designed to withstand harsh aggregate environments. A major supplier in Belt and Road regions.

6. Deere & Company (USA)

Commonly known as John Deere, they are celebrated for advanced telematics systems and versatile quick-coupler attachments for construction and farming.

7. LiuGong Machinery Co., Ltd. (China)

Recognized for creating highly robust, easy-to-maintain mid-range loaders that operate efficiently in extreme climates, from desert heat to polar regions.

8. SANY Group (China)

Features highly competitive pricing structures paired with rapid technology integration, including the implementation of 5G autonomous remote-control operations.

9. SDLG (Shandong Lingong Construction Machinery Co., Ltd.)

Partnered with Volvo, SDLG focuses on simple, reliable, and highly competitive value-segment wheel loaders for bulk materials and agricultural use.

Localized Application Scenarios for Front End Loaders

The operational environment dictates the required configurations of the loader:

  • Port Logistics & Bulk Handling: Requires high-speed cycle times, reinforced boom arms, and high-dump clearance buckets. Highly optimized for handling container logistics and coal bulk loading.
  • Demolition and Waste Management: Necessitates heavy guard packages, solid tires, and specialized high-durability buckets to withstand harsh municipal debris.
  • Agricultural Bulk Handling: Typically requires compact maneuverability, low-ground-pressure tires, and compatibility with diverse front attachments like silage forks, hay clamps, and sweepers.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is the typical lifespan of a front-end loader?

A well-maintained commercial wheel loader can operate productively for 10,000 to 15,000 hours. The lifespan is deeply influenced by the quality of regular hydraulic oil flushing, engine servicing, and grease cycles.

How do I calculate the TCO of my loader fleet?

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) is calculated as: Acquisition Cost + Fuel/Power consumption over lifespan + Scheduled Maintenance & Unscheduled Downtime Losses - Residual Resale Value. Electric loaders typically offer a higher purchase cost but significantly lower running costs.

What safety certifications are required for import into the EU and North America?

All heavy equipment entering the EU must bear the CE mark, indicating compliance with Machinery Directive 2006/42/EC. In North America, OSHA and ANSI standards dictate the integration of certified Roll-Over Protective Structures (ROPS) and Falling-Object Protective Structures (FOPS).
